Legal and Regulative Compliance: Browsing the Labyrinth
Ever questioned why home managers frequently appear like walking encyclopedias of real estate laws!.?. !? It's not just luck; it's large need. One missed out on provision in a lease or an ignored local regulation can spiral into expensive conflicts or fines. Envision the headache when a tenant declares their rights were ignored because a property manager missed out on an update in reasonable real estate guidelines. Remaining ahead of these shifting sands requires vigilance and an intimate understanding of both federal and regional statutes.
Why does compliance feel like juggling flaming torches? Because laws evolve, and each jurisdiction has its own twist on guidelines about tenant screening, eviction procedures, and upkeep standards (Property Management Firms). Some cities require lead paint disclosures while others impose rigorous limitations on security deposits. Knowing these nuances isn't just useful-- it's important
Professional Tips for Remaining Certified
- Subscribe to legal update services particular to residential or commercial property management; overlooking them resembles strolling blind.
- Establish a list customized to your location covering whatever from lease terms to security evaluations.
- Train your group routinely on compliance subjects-- in some cases a quick refresher avoids a costly legal slip.
- Document every interaction and transaction meticulously; courts enjoy clear paper tracks.
Typical Pitfalls to Dodge
Location | Common Oversight | Proactive Solution |
---|---|---|
Expulsion Notices | Inaccurate timing or phrasing | Use design templates vetted by legal experts and double-check local laws |
Lease Agreements | Missing out on state-mandated disclosures | Keep a compliance checklist upgraded for each jurisdiction |
Maintenance Demands | Overlooking statutory deadlines | Implement tracking software application with informs for urgent repairs |
